Zeros of the derivatives of Faber polynomials associated with a universal covering map

Abstract: For a compact set EsubsetmathbbC containing more than two points, we study asymptotic behavior of normalized zero counting measures muk of the derivatives of Faber polynomials associated with E. For example if E has empty interior, we prove that muk converges in the weak-star topology to a measure whose support is the boundary of g(mathcalD), where is a universal covering map such that g(infty)=infty and mathcalD is the Dirichlet domain associated with g and centered at infty. Our results are counterparts of those of Kuijlaars and Saff (1995) on zeros of Faber polynomials.
